The Evolution of Stealth Technology
Stealth technology has revolutionized modern warfare, allowing military aircraft to evade detection and remain virtually invisible to enemy radar systems. The F-22 Raptor embodies the pinnacle of stealth capabilities, making it a game-changer in the skies.
The development of the F-22 Raptor can be traced back to the 1980s, when the U.S. Air Force recognized the need for a next-generation fighter jet that could outmaneuver and outwit potential adversaries. With the Cold War tensions escalating, the requirement for an advanced, stealthy aircraft became crucial.
The F-22 Raptor's stealth capabilities are a result of meticulous engineering and innovative design. Its airframe is shaped to minimize radar cross-section, reducing its visibility to enemy radar systems. Advanced materials, such as radar-absorbent coatings and composite structures, are utilized to further enhance its stealth properties.
One of the key features contributing to the F-22's stealth is its use of internal weapons bays. By storing its missiles and other ordnance internally, the aircraft's radar signature is significantly reduced, making it harder to detect. This design choice not only enhances its stealth capabilities but also improves its overall aerodynamics.

Unmatched Maneuverability and Performance
The F-22 Raptor's performance and maneuverability are truly remarkable. Its advanced aerodynamic design, combined with powerful engines, enables it to achieve incredible speeds and acceleration. With a top speed of over Mach 2, the F-22 can outrun most modern fighter jets, giving it a decisive advantage in air combat.
The F-22's thrust vectoring capabilities further enhance its maneuverability. By manipulating the direction of engine thrust, the pilot can perform tight turns and high-angle-of-attack maneuvers, making it extremely agile and difficult to outmaneuver. This level of agility, coupled with its stealth technology, makes the F-22 a formidable opponent in any aerial engagement.
Additionally, the F-22's advanced flight control system allows for precise and responsive control, even at high speeds and during high-G maneuvers. This ensures that the pilot can maintain control and make precise adjustments, further enhancing the aircraft's overall performance.
